Tiago Nunes Takes Responsibility for Liga de Quito's Defeat: 'If There is Any Responsibility, Mainly it's Me'

Tiago Nunes, after the loss to Macará, took full responsibility for Liga de Quito's performance and noted the team's collective struggles rather than attributing blame to individual players.

After Liga Deportiva Universitaria's defeat against Macará in the Liga Pro Serie A 2026, Tiago Nunes held a press conference where he accepted responsibility for the team's poor performance. He emphasized that he does not believe in assigning blame to individual players, stating, 'if there is any responsibility, mainly it's me.' Nunes pointed out that the team failed to generate clear gameplay, which has been a significant concern as it deviates from their previous performances.

Additionally, Nunes highlighted that the match conditions were challenging, particularly noting that the team played with one less player for most of the match due to an early sending off. This created further difficulties for the squad, especially under the intense heat at the stadium. He explained that while the players did not perform as a cohesive unit, his primary role as the coach is to prepare them, suggesting that he needs to assess and improve the team's tactical approach in future matches.
